M.I.X.
(Random
Play)
Press
4(M.I.X.)
in
the play or pause mode.
The
"CQ
M.I.X:
indicator lights up, and the tracks (files) on the
disc will
be
played
back
in
random sequence.
Press 4(M.I.X.) again
to
cancel.
Folder
M.I.X.
(Random
Play)
(MP3/
WMA/AAC)
Press and hold
4(M.I.X.)
for at least 2 seconds.
The
"D
FOLDER" and
"CQ
M.I.X." indicators appear in the
display, and all files in the current folder are played
back
in
random
sequence.
Press and hold 4(M.I.X.) again
to
cancel.
Scanning
Programs
Press
5(SCAN)
to activate the scan mode.
The first
10
seconds
of
each track
(file)
will
be
played
back
in
succession.
Press
5(SCAN)
again
to
cancel.
Folder
Scanning
Programs
(MP3/WMA/
AAC)
Press and hold
5(SCAN)
for at least 2 seconds.
From the next folder, the first
10
seconds
of the first file in each
folder
is
played
back
in sequence.
Press and hold
5(SCAN)
again to cancel.

What
is
MP3?
MP3, whose official name
is
"MPEG-1 Audio Layer 3,"
is
a
compression standard prescribed by the
ISO,
the International
Standardization Organization and
MPEG
which
is
a joint activity
institution of the
IEC.
MP3 files contain compressed audio data. MP3 encoding
is
capable of compressing audio data
at
extremely high ratios,
reducing the size of music files to
as
much
as
one-tenth their
original
size.
This
is
achieved while still maintaining near CD quality.
The MP3 format realises such high compression ratios by
eliminating the sounds that are either inaudible to the human ear or
masked by other sounds.
What
is
WMA?
WMA, or "Windows Media
™ Audio."
is
compressed audio data.
WMA
is
similar to MP3 audio data and can achieve CD quality
sound with small
file
sizes.
What
isAAC?
MC
is
the abbreviation for "Advanced Audio Coding," and
is
a
basic format of audio compression used
by
MPEG2 or MPEG4.
Method for creating MP3IWMAlAAC files
Audio data
is
compressed using software with
MP3IWMNMC
codecs. For details
on
creating
MP3IWMNMC
files,
refer to the
user's manual for that software.
MP3IWMNMC
files
that are playable on this device have the
file
extensions "mp3" / "wma" / "m4a."
Files
with no extension cannot
be played back (WMA
ver.
7-9 are supported). Protected
files
are
not supported, neither are raw
MC
files
(using the ".aac"
extension).
There are many different versions of the
MC
format. Confirm that
the software being used conforms to the acceptable formats listed
above. It's possible that the format may be unplayable even though
the extension
is
valid.
Playback of
MC
files encoded by iTunes
is
supported.
